**Q: Why does Feedwright reject my plugin's generated episodes?**

Feedwright validates enclosure lengths strictly; if your plugin emits a placeholder byte count, the feed fails. Compute actual file sizes before publishing, or mark the field deferred. Validation rules and the plugin conformance checklist are maintained on the page below.

operations page: https://jenkins.zemvarcloud.local/job/merge_requests/repo/build/73930b4b30f0a8ed

### Inventory reconciliation job stuck

If the nightly Stockfern recon job hangs past 03:00, it's almost always a stale cursor in the ledger snapshot. Kick the job with the replay flag and watch the Dunmore queue drain — usually clears in ten minutes. If you need to hit the admin replay endpoint manually, use this token.

session JWT of yawep-yawep = eyJhbGciOiJIUzI1NiIsInR5cCI6IkpXVCJ9.eyJzdWIiOiI3pWF3_In0.aXYsHiog

The Lumenfold contrast audit fails only on the nightly Bramble runner because it renders with a stale theme cache, reporting false ratios on button states. Clear the runner's asset cache before escalating to the design team. When filing a report, quote the failing stage and include the trace token below.

pipeline stamp: htk9_ce63042d9

Internal Memo — Heads of Department

Subject: Closure of the Marlowe Street office

The Marlowe Street site will close at quarter end. Eleven roles move to the Ashgrove hub; three are made redundant under standard terms. Facilities handles asset disposal; HR runs consultations starting next week. Keep this within your leadership teams until the all-hands. Budget savings are earmarked already, and the intended use is set out below.

internal memo for bawef-kajef: Novokix Logistics is in early talks to buy Briaelax Freight for about $167.0 million. The Zorius launch date is April 3, and nothing goes to the press before then. Legal wants the Frairax Holdings term sheet redrafted before August 10.